About Moulay Ismail University

Basic information and contact details for Moulay Ismail University

Moulay Ismail University was established in 1989 and has since become one of the leading institutions of higher education in Morocco. It is named after Moulay Ismaïl, a Sultan of Morocco from 1672-1727. The university’s main campus is located in Meknes, a city in northern Morocco. Meknes combines the old and the new with its medina which is full of historical sights, and its ville nouvelle which, less than three miles away, is home to modern cars, houses and well-known brands. The university also has a smaller campus located in the southern city of Errachidia. The city is situated between the High Atlas Mountains and the sand hills of the desert. When the university was first established it had just two schools: the school of sciences and the school of arts and humanities. It is now home to eight schools: sciences, arts and humanities, law, economics and social sciences, sciences and technology, engineering, the graduate school of technology, the polydisciplinary school, and the school of teaching training. Each school offers a range of courses at bachelor, masters and doctorate level. Students are given the opportunity to study abroad as part of the university’s academic exchange programme. The university has developed partnerships with more than 200 universities across Europe, Asia, the Middle East and North America to facilitate these exchanges.

Key Student Statistics

A breakdown of student statistics at Moulay Ismail University

gender ratio
Student gender ratio
55 F : 45 M (1)
globe fill
International student percentage
1% (1)
student per staff
Students per staff
54.9 (1)
student
Student total
79507 (1)

Based on data collected for the (1) World University Rankings 2026

Subjects Taught at Moulay Ismail University

See below for a range of subjects taught at Moulay Ismail University

Arts and Humanities

  • Archaeology
  • Art, Performing Art and Design
  • History, Philosophy and Theology
  • Languages, Literature and Linguistics

Business and Economics

  • Accounting and Finance
  • Business and Management
  • Economics and Econometrics

Computer Science

  • Computer Science

Education Studies

  • Education

Engineering

  • Chemical Engineering
  • Civil Engineering
  • Electrical and Electronic Engineering
  • General Engineering
  • Mechanical and Aerospace Engineering

Law

  • Law

Life Sciences

  • Agriculture and Forestry
  • Biological Sciences
  • Sport Science

Medical and Health

  • Other Health

Physical Sciences

  • Chemistry
  • Geology, Environmental, Earth and Marine Sciences
  • Mathematics and Statistics
  • Physics and Astronomy

Psychology

  • Psychology

Social Sciences

  • Communication and Media Studies
  • Geography
  • Politics and International Studies
  • Sociology
